Abstract :
A 2-D retrodirective array based on phase detection and heterodyne scanning is presented. The system integrates two single voltage-controlled oscillator phase-shifting networks that are autonomously controlled via a phase-detecting array and control circuit that eliminates the R4 path loss typical of other retrodirective arrays. Retrodirectivity is reported for angles of 0deg, +15deg, and -15deg at a transmitting frequency of 6.5 GHz.
